Israel's military is employing an artificial intelligence system to identify and target individuals associated with Hezbollah. This AI fuses data from various sources, including smartphones, cameras, and social media, to track targets. Experts express concern that such AI-driven systems could lead to misidentification and unintended civilian casualties. AI
